Why Invest in Lisbon?

Lisbon is a city that has captured the hearts of many, with its stunning architecture, rich history, and charming atmosphere. But besides its undeniable charm, Lisbon offers many advantages to real estate investors.

For starters, Lisbon has a thriving economy that has been growing steadily in recent years. The city is home to many multinational companies and startups, making it an attractive destination for professionals and entrepreneurs. This has resulted in a growing demand for housing, which has been driving up property prices. In fact, property prices in Lisbon have been rising faster than any other city in Europe, making it a hot spot for real estate investment.

Additionally, Portugal has a tax regime that is very favorable to real estate investors. Non-habitual residents (NHRs) can benefit from a flat income tax rate of 20% for a period of ten years. This makes it an attractive option for individuals considering citizenship and residency by investment options around the world.

Areas to Invest in Lisbon

When it comes to investing in real estate in Lisbon, there are several areas that are worth considering. Here are some of the most popular:

  • Baixa and Chiado: These areas are in the heart of Lisbon and are known for their historic buildings, trendy shops, and vibrant nightlife.
  • Graça: This neighborhood is located on a hill overlooking the city and offers stunning views of Lisbon.
  • Alfama: This is the oldest neighborhood in Lisbon and is known for its narrow streets, colorful buildings, and traditional fado music.
  • Parque das Nações: This is a modern neighborhood that was built for the 1998 World Expo and is now a hub for business and entertainment.

The Lisbon Real Estate Market

The Lisbon real estate market has grown rapidly in recent years, with a surge in demand from international buyers. The city’s vibrant culture, excellent quality of life, and attractive tax incentives make it an appealing destination for those seeking citizenship and residency by investment options around the world.

One of the most significant advantages of investing in Lisbon real estate is its affordability compared to other major European cities. According to data from the Global Property Guide, the average price per square meter in Lisbon is around €4,000, while in Paris, it is around €10,000.

Debunking the Myth of Overpriced Properties

While it is true that Lisbon has experienced a rise in property prices, it is not accurate to say that properties are overpriced. Lisbon’s real estate prices are still lower than other major European cities, making it an attractive investment opportunity.

Furthermore, it is important to note that Lisbon’s real estate market operates differently from other European cities, where values are often inflated by speculative forces. In Lisbon, the market is driven by a genuine demand for property, which is supported by Portugal’s Golden Visa program and tax incentives for non-habitual residents.

One of the most important things that anyone wanting to settle here needs to know about is the NIF, or the “Número de Identificação Fiscal.”

    The NIF is a unique tax identification number that is required for anyone living in Portugal and engaging in any kind of financial activity. It is essential for opening a bank account, paying taxes, buying a property, and even getting a mobile phone contract. As such, obtaining a NIF is a crucial step for anyone relocating to Portugal.

    At first, the process of getting a NIF can seem a little overwhelming, especially if you are not familiar with the language or the bureaucracy. But don’t worry, I have helped many of my clients successfully obtain their NIFs, and I can tell you from personal experience that it is not as complicated as it may seem.

    There are two main ways to get a NIF in Portugal: one is to go to a tax office in person and fill out the necessary forms, and the other is to appoint someone to act as your legal representative and obtain the number on your behalf. I usually recommend the latter option to my clients, as it is much more convenient and saves them the hassle of dealing with the bureaucracy themselves.
